Description

Chile-Cheese Corn Bread is a savory twist on the classic corn bread, infusing it with the bold flavors of chiles and the richness of cheese. This dish finds its roots in American cuisine, particularly in the South and Southwest, where corn bread is a staple and chiles are a beloved ingredient. Combining these elements with cheese creates a fusion that appeals to those seeking a heartier, spicier bread option. The major ingredients include cornmeal, fresh corn kernels, serrano chiles, and a choice of Manchego or extra-sharp Cheddar cheese, making it gluten-free and adaptable to dietary preferences. The cooking method involves sautéing corn and chiles, mixing wet and dry ingredients separately, combining them with cheese, and then baking. This results in a bread that is moist, with a slightly crunchy exterior, and packed with the heat of chiles balanced by the creamy, melty cheese. Instructions
  1. Prepare the Oven and Pan

    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C). Take out trusty 11-by-7-by-2-inch (28-by-18-by-5-cm) glass baking dish and give it a brush with olive oil. Heat up a tablespoon of olive oil in a frying pan over medium-high heat. Toss in the corn and chiles and let them dance until they're tinged with golden brown, about 4 minutes. Once done, let them cool off.

  2. Sauté and Cool

    Combine milk and vinegar in a glass measuring pitcher and let them mingle until they thicken, around 5 minutes. Add in the remaining olive oil and crack in the egg. Whisk it all together with a fork until it's one happy blend.

  3. Mixing Magic

    In a large bowl, whisk together the cornmeal, sorghum flour, brown sugar, tapioca flour, baking powder, marjoram, salt, xanthan gum, baking soda, and a generous dash of pepper. Pour in the liquid mixture and stir until it's all snugly combined. Then, fold in the corn-chile mixture and cheese, ensuring every bit is well-acquainted.

  4. Baking Brilliance

    Pour batter into the prepared pan, spreading it out evenly with a trusty rubber spatula and smoothing the top for that perfect finish. Pop it into the oven and let the magic happen. Bake until it's golden brown, springy to the touch, and a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ean, about 25 minutes of anticipation. Once it's reached its full potential, transfer your creation to a wire rack and let it cool in the pan for 15 minutes. Finally, slice into warm, inviting pieces and savor the delightful aroma and taste of your homemade spicy cornbread with chiles. Enjoy it fresh out of the oven.
